Rhode Island SB 2980 (2018) — AN ACT RELATING TO ANIMALS AND ANIMAL HUSBANDRY -- DISPOSITION OF RESEARCH ANIMALS (Requires educational institutions using dogs or cats for medical research to make animals no longer useful for research available for adoption.)
